3111 | Hockey_stick_controversy | Ljungqvist's millennial temperature reconstruction was very similar to Moberg et al. | Hockey stick controversy In the hockey stick controversy , the data and methods used in reconstructions of the temperature record of the past 1000 years have been disputed . Reconstructions have consistently shown that the rise in the instrumental temperature record of the past 150 years is not matched in earlier centuries , and the name `` hockey stick graph '' was coined for figures showing a long-term decline followed by an abrupt rise in temperatures . These graphs were publicised to explain the scientific findings of climatology , and in addition to scientific debate over the reconstructions , they have been the topic of political dispute . The issue is part of the global warming controversy and has been one focus of political responses to reports by the Intergovernmental Panel on Climate Change ( IPCC ) . Arguments over the reconstructions have been taken up by fossil fuel industry funded lobbying groups attempting to cast doubt on climate science . The use of proxy indicators to get quantitative estimates of the temperature record of past centuries was developed from the 1990s onwards , and found indications that recent warming was exceptional . The reconstruction introduced the `` Composite Plus Scaling '' ( CPS ) method used by most later large-scale reconstructions , and its findings were disputed by Patrick Michaels at the United States House Committee on Science . In 1998 , Michael E. Mann , Raymond S. Bradley and Malcolm K. Hughes developed new statistical techniques to produce ( MBH98 ) , the first eigenvector-based climate field reconstruction ( CFR ) . This showed global patterns of annual surface temperature , and included a graph of average hemispheric temperatures back to 1400 . In ( MBH99 ) the methodology was extended back to 1000 . The term hockey stick was coined by the climatologist Jerry D. Mahlman , to describe the pattern this showed , envisaging a graph that is relatively flat to 1900 as forming an ice hockey stick 's `` shaft '' , followed by a sharp increase corresponding to the `` blade '' . A version of this graph was featured prominently in the 2001 IPCC Third Assessment Report ( TAR ) , along with four other reconstructions supporting the same conclusion . The graph was publicised , and became a focus of dispute for those opposed to the strengthening scientific consensus that late 20th-century warmth was exceptional . Those disputing the graph included Pat Michaels , the George C. Marshall Institute and Fred Singer . A paper by Willie Soon and Sallie Baliunas claiming greater medieval warmth was used by the Bush administration chief of staff Philip Cooney to justify altering the first Environmental Protection Agency Report on the Environment . The paper was quickly dismissed by scientists in the Soon and Baliunas controversy , but on July 28 , Republican Jim Inhofe spoke in the Senate citing it to claim `` that man-made global warming is the greatest hoax ever perpetrated on the American people '' . Later in 2003 , a paper by Steve McIntyre and Ross McKitrick disputing the data used in MBH98 paper was publicised by the George C. Marshall Institute and the Competitive Enterprise Institute . In 2004 , Hans von Storch published criticism of the statistical techniques as tending to underplay variations in earlier parts of the graph , though this was disputed and he later accepted that the effect was very small . In 2005 , McIntyre and McKitrick published criticisms of the principal component analysis methodology as used in MBH98 and MBH99 . The analysis therein was subsequently disputed by published papers , including and , which pointed to errors in the McIntyre and McKitrick methodology . In June 2005 , Rep. Joe Barton launched what Sherwood Boehlert , chairman of the House Science Committee , called a `` misguided and illegitimate investigation '' into the data , methods and personal information of Mann , Bradley and Hughes . At Boehlert 's request , a panel of scientists convened by the National Research Council was set up , which reported in 2006 , supporting Mann 's findings with some qualifications , including agreeing that there were some statistical failings but these had little effect on the result . Barton and U.S. Rep. Ed Whitfield requested Edward Wegman to set up a team of statisticians to investigate , and they supported McIntyre and McKitrick 's view that there were statistical failings , although they did not quantify whether there was any significant effect . They also produced an extensive network analysis which has been discredited by expert opinion and found to have issues of plagiarism . Arguments against the MBH studies were reintroduced as part of the Climatic Research Unit email controversy , but dismissed by eight independent investigations . More than two dozen reconstructions , using various statistical methods and combinations of proxy records , have supported the broad consensus shown in the original 1998 hockey-stick graph , with variations in how flat the pre-20th century `` shaft '' appears . The 2007 IPCC Fourth Assessment Report cited 14 reconstructions , 10 of which covered 1,000 years or longer , to support its strengthened conclusion that it was likely that Northern Hemisphere temperatures during the 20th century were the highest in at least the past 1,300 years . Over a dozen subsequent reconstructions , including Mann et al. 2008 and , have supported these general conclusions . |

2378 | Stern_Review | The costs of inaction far outweigh the costs of mitigation. | Stern Review The Stern Review on the Economics of Climate Change is a 700-page report released for the Government of the United Kingdom on 30 October 2006 by economist Nicholas Stern , chair of the Grantham Research Institute on Climate Change and the Environment at the London School of Economics ( LSE ) and also chair of the Centre for Climate Change Economics and Policy ( CCCEP ) at Leeds University and LSE . The report discusses the effect of global warming on the world economy . Although not the first economic report on climate change , it is significant as the largest and most widely known and discussed report of its kind . The Review states that climate change is the greatest and widest-ranging market failure ever seen , presenting a unique challenge for economics . The Review provides prescriptions including environmental taxes to minimise the economic and social disruptions . The Stern Review 's main conclusion is that the benefits of strong , early action on climate change far outweigh the costs of not acting . The Review points to the potential impacts of climate change on water resources , food production , health , and the environment . According to the Review , without action , the overall costs of climate change will be equivalent to losing at least 5 % of global gross domestic product ( GDP ) each year , now and forever . Including a wider range of risks and impacts could increase this to 20 % of GDP or more , also indefinitely . Stern believes that 5 -- 6 degrees of temperature increase is `` a real possibility . '' The Review proposes that one percent of global GDP per annum is required to be invested to avoid the worst effects of climate change . In June 2008 , Stern increased the estimate for the annual cost of achieving stabilisation between 500 and 550 ppm CO2e to 2 % of GDP to account for faster than expected climate change . There has been a mixed reaction to the Stern Review from economists . Several economists have been critical of the Review , for example , a paper by Byatt et al. ( 2006 ) describes the Review as `` deeply flawed '' . Some economists ( such as Brad DeLong and John Quiggin ) have supported the Review . Others have criticised aspects of Review 's analysis , but argued that some of its conclusions might still be justified based on other grounds , e.g. , see papers by Martin Weitzman ( 2007 ) and Dieter Helm ( 2008 ) . |
2837 | Tendency_of_the_rate_of_profit_to_fall | In fact, the rate of increase from September onward is the fastest rate of change on record, either upwards or downwards. | Tendency of the rate of profit to fall The tendency of the rate of profit to fall ( TRPF ) is a hypothesis in economics and political economy , most famously expounded by Karl Marx in chapter 13 of Capital , Volume III . Although not accepted in 20th century mainstream economics , the existence of such a tendency was widely accepted in the 19th century . Economists as diverse as Adam Smith , John Stuart Mill , David Ricardo and Stanley Jevons referred explicitly to the TRPF as an empirical phenomenon . They differed in their explanation about why the TRPF might occur . In his 1857 Grundrisse manuscript , Karl Marx called the tendency of the rate of profit to fall `` the most important law of political economy '' and sought to give a causal explanation for it , in terms of his theory of capital accumulation . The tendency is already foreshadowed in chapter 25 of Capital , Volume I ( on the `` general law of capital accumulation '' ) , but in Part 3 of the draft manuscript of Marx 's Capital , Volume III , edited posthumously for publication by Friedrich Engels , an extensive analysis is provided of the tendency . Marx regarded the TRPF as proof that capitalist production could not be an everlasting form of production , since , in the end , the profit principle itself would suffer a breakdown . However , because Marx never published any finished manuscript on the TRPF himself , because the tendency is hard to prove or disprove theoretically , and because it is hard to test and measure the rate of profit , Marx 's TRPF theory has been a topic of controversy for more than a century . |

2011 | Emissions_trading | U.S. Pays $1 Billion into Green Climate Fund, Top Polluters Pay Nothing | Emissions trading Emissions trading or cap and trade is a government-mandated , market-based approach to controlling pollution by providing economic incentives for achieving reductions in the emissions of pollutants . In contrast to command-and-control environmental regulations such as best available technology ( BAT ) standards and government subsidies , cap and trade ( CAT ) schemes are a type of flexible environmental regulation that allows organizations to decide how best to meet policy targets . Various countries , states and groups of companies have adopted such trading systems , notably for mitigating climate change . A central authority ( usually a governmental body ) allocates or sells a limited number of permits to discharge specific quantities of a specific pollutant per time period . Polluters are required to hold permits in amount equal to their emissions . Polluters that want to increase their emissions must buy permits from others willing to sell them . Financial derivatives of permits can also be traded on secondary markets . In theory , polluters who can reduce emissions most cheaply will do so , achieving the emission reduction at the lowest cost to society . Cap and trade is meant to provide the private sector with the flexibility required to reduce emissions while stimulating technological innovation and economic growth . There are active trading programs in several air pollutants . For greenhouse gases , which cause climate change , permit units are often called carbon credits . The largest greenhouse gases trading program is the European Union Emission Trading Scheme , which trades primarily in European Union Allowances ( EUAs ) ; the Californian scheme trades in California Carbon Allowances , the New Zealand scheme in New Zealand Units and the Australian scheme in Australian Units . The United States has a national market to reduce acid rain and several regional markets in nitrogen oxides . |

1783 | Global_warming_hiatus | Internal variability can only account for small amounts of warming and cooling over periods of decades, and scientific studies have consistently shown that it cannot account for the global warming over the past century. | Global warming hiatus A global warming hiatus , also sometimes referred to as a global warming pause or a global warming slowdown , is a period of relatively little change in globally averaged surface temperatures . In the current episode of global warming many such 15-year periods appear in the surface temperature record , along with robust evidence of the long-term warming trend ; climate is classically averaged over 30-year periods . Publicity has surrounded claims of a global warming hiatus during the period 1998 -- 2013 . The exceptionally warm El Niño year of 1998 was an outlier from the continuing temperature trend , and so subsequent annual temperatures gave the appearance of a hiatus : by January 2006 , it appeared to some that global warming had stopped or paused . A 2009 study showed that decades without warming were not exceptional , and in 2011 a study showed that if allowances were made for known variability , the rising temperature trend continued unabated . There was increased public interest in 2013 in the run-up to publication of the IPCC Fifth Assessment Report , and despite concerns that a 15-year period was too short to determine a meaningful trend , the IPCC included a section on a hiatus , which it defined as a much smaller increasing linear trend over the 15 years from 1998 to 2012 , than over the 60 years from 1951 to 2012 . Various studies examined possible causes of the short-term slowdown . Even though the overall climate system has continued to accumulate energy due to Earth 's positive energy budget , the available temperature readings at the Earth 's surface indicate slower rates of increase in surface warming than in the prior decade . Since measurements at the top of the atmosphere show that Earth is receiving more energy than it is radiating back into space , the retained energy should be producing warming in the Earth 's climate system . Research reported in July 2015 on an updated NOAA dataset casts doubt on the existence of a hiatus , and it finds no indication of a slowdown even in earlier years . Scientists working on other datasets welcomed this study , though they have expressed the view that the recent warming trend was less than in previous periods of the same length . Subsequently , a detailed study supports the conclusion that warming is continuing , but it also find there was less warming between 2001 and 2010 than climate models had predicted , and that this slowdown might be attributed to short-term variations in the Pacific decadal oscillation ( PDO ) , which was negative during that period . Another review finds `` no substantive evidence '' of a pause in global warming . A statistical study of global temperature data since 1970 concludes that the term ` hiatus ' or ` pause ' is not justified . Independent of these discussions about data and measurements for earlier years , 2015 turned out to be much warmer than any of the earlier years , already before El Niño conditions started . The warmth of 2015 largely ended any remaining scientific credibility of claims that the supposed `` hiatus '' since 1998 had any significance for the long-term warming trend . In January 2017 , a study published in the journal Science Advances cast further doubt on the existence of a recent pause , with more evidence that ocean temperatures have been underestimated . An April 2017 study found the data consistent with a steady warming trend globally since the 1970s , with fluctuations within the expected range of short term variability . |

2924 | Ice_core | The long-term correlation between CO2 and temperature is well established. | Ice core An ice core is a core sample that is typically removed from an ice sheet , most commonly from the polar ice caps of Antarctica , Greenland or from high mountain glaciers elsewhere . As the ice forms from the incremental buildup of annual layers of snow , lower layers are older than upper , and an ice core contains ice formed over a range of years . The properties of the ice and the recrystallized inclusions within the ice can then be used to reconstruct a climatic record over the age range of the core , normally through isotopic analysis . This enables the reconstruction of local temperature records and the history of atmospheric composition . Ice cores contain an abundance of information about climate . Inclusions in the snow of each year remain in the ice , such as wind-blown dust , ash , pollen , bubbles of atmospheric gas and radioactive substances . The variety of climatic proxies is greater than in any other natural recorder of climate , such as tree rings or sediment layers . These include ( proxies for ) temperature , ocean volume , precipitation , chemistry and gas composition of the lower atmosphere , volcanic eruptions , solar variability , sea-surface productivity , desert extent and forest fires . The length of the record depends on the depth of the ice core and varies from a few years up to 800 kyr ( 800,000 years ) for the EPICA core . The time resolution ( i.e. the shortest time period which can be accurately distinguished ) depends on the amount of annual snowfall , and reduces with depth as the ice compacts under the weight of layers accumulating on top of it . Upper layers of ice in a core correspond to a single year or sometimes a single season . Deeper into the ice the layers thin and annual layers become indistinguishable . An ice core from the right site can be used to reconstruct an uninterrupted and detailed climate record extending over hundreds of thousands of years , providing information on a wide variety of aspects of climate at each point in time . It is the simultaneity of these properties recorded in the ice that makes ice cores such a powerful tool in paleoclimate research . |
2200 | Climate_change_denial | The Petition Project features over 31,000 scientists signing the petition stating "There is no convincing scientific evidence that human release of carbon dioxide will, in the forseeable future, cause catastrophic heating of the Earth's atmosphere ...". | Climate change denial Climate change denial , or global warming denial , is part of the global warming controversy . It involves denial , dismissal , unwarranted doubt or contrarian views which strongly depart from the scientific opinion on climate change , including the extent to which it is caused by humans , its impacts on nature and human society , or the potential of adaptation to global warming by human actions . Some deniers do endorse the term , but others often prefer the term climate change skepticism , although this is a misnomer for those who deny anthropogenic global warming . In effect , the two terms form a continuous , overlapping range of views , and generally have the same characteristics : both reject , to a greater or lesser extent , mainstream scientific opinion on climate change . Climate change denial can also be implicit , when individuals or social groups accept the science but fail to come to terms with it or to translate their acceptance into action . Several social science studies have analyzed these positions as forms of denialism . Campaigning to undermine public trust in climate science has been described as a `` denial machine '' of industrial , political and ideological interests , supported by conservative media and skeptical bloggers in manufacturing uncertainty about global warming . In the public debate , phrases such as climate skepticism have frequently been used with the same meaning as climate denialism . The labels are contested : those actively challenging climate science commonly describe themselves as `` skeptics '' , but many do not comply with common standards of scientific skepticism and , regardless of evidence , persistently deny the validity of human caused global warming . Although scientific opinion on climate change is that human activity is extremely likely to be the primary driver of climate change , the politics of global warming have been affected by climate change denial , hindering efforts to prevent climate change and adapt to the warming climate . Those promoting denial commonly use rhetorical tactics to give the appearance of a scientific controversy where there is none . Of the world 's countries , the climate change denial industry is most powerful in the United States . Since January 2015 , the United States Senate Committee on Environment and Public Works has been chaired by oil lobbyist and climate change denier Jim Inhofe . Inhofe is notorious for having called climate change `` the greatest hoax ever perpetrated against the American people '' and for having claimed to have debunked the alleged hoax in February 2015 when he brought a snowball with him in the Senate chamber and tossed it across the floor . Organised campaigning to undermine public trust in climate science is associated with conservative economic policies and backed by industrial interests opposed to the regulation of emissions . Climate change denial has been associated with the fossil fuels lobby , the Koch brothers , industry advocates and libertarian think tanks , often in the United States . More than 90 % of papers sceptical on climate change originate from right-wing think tanks . The total annual income of these climate change counter-movement-organizations is roughly $ 900 million . Between 2002 and 2010 , nearly $ 120 million ( # 77 million ) was anonymously donated via the Donors Trust and Donors Capital Fund to more than 100 organisations seeking to undermine the public perception of the science on climate change . In 2013 the Center for Media and Democracy reported that the State Policy Network ( SPN ) , an umbrella group of 64 U.S. think tanks , had been lobbying on behalf of major corporations and conservative donors to oppose climate change regulation . Since the late 1970s , oil companies have published research broadly in line with the standard views on global warming . Despite this , oil companies organized a climate change denial campaign to disseminate public disinformation for several decades , a strategy that has been compared to the organized denial of the hazards of tobacco smoking by tobacco companies . |

10 | Carbon_dioxide_in_Earth's_atmosphere | Human additions of CO2 are in the margin of error of current measurements and the gradual increase in CO2 is mainly from oceans degassing as the planet slowly emerges from the last ice age. | Carbon dioxide in Earth's atmosphere Carbon dioxide is an important trace gas in Earth 's atmosphere . Currently it constitutes about 0.041 % ( equal to 410 parts per million ; ppm ) by volume of the atmosphere . Despite its relatively small concentration is a potent greenhouse gas and plays a vital role in regulating Earth 's surface temperature through radiative forcing and the greenhouse effect . Reconstructions show that concentrations of in the atmosphere have varied , ranging from as high as 7,000 ppm during the Cambrian period about 500 million years ago to as low as 180 ppm during the Quaternary glaciation of the last two million years . Carbon dioxide is an integral part of the carbon cycle , a biogeochemical cycle in which carbon is exchanged between the Earth 's oceans , soil , rocks and the biosphere . Plants and other photoautotrophs use solar energy to produce carbohydrate from atmospheric carbon dioxide and water by photosynthesis . Almost all other organisms depend on carbohydrate derived from photosynthesis as their primary source of energy and carbon compounds . The current episode of global warming is attributed to increasing emissions of and other greenhouse gases into Earth 's atmosphere . The global annual mean concentration of in the atmosphere has increased by more than 40 % since the start of the Industrial Revolution , from 280 ppm , the level it had for the last 10,000 years leading up to the mid-18th century , to 399 ppm as of 2015 . The present concentration is the highest in at least the past 800,000 years and likely the highest in the past 20 million years . The increase has been caused by anthropogenic sources , particularly the burning of fossil fuels and deforestation . The daily average concentration of atmospheric CO2 at Mauna Loa Observatory first exceeded 400 ppm on 10 May 2013 . It is currently rising at a rate of approximately 2 ppm/year and accelerating . An estimated 30 -- 40 % of the released by humans into the atmosphere dissolves into oceans , rivers and lakes , which contributes to ocean acidification . |
2132 | Climatic_Research_Unit_email_controversy | Freedom of Information (FOI) requests were ignored | Climatic Research Unit email controversy The Climatic Research Unit email controversy ( also known as `` Climategate '' ) began in November 2009 with the hacking of a server at the Climatic Research Unit ( CRU ) at the University of East Anglia ( UEA ) by an external attacker , copying thousands of emails and computer files , the Climatic Research Unit documents , to various internet locations several weeks before the Copenhagen Summit on climate change . The story was first broken by climate change denialists with columnist James Delingpole popularising the term `` Climategate '' to describe the controversy . Several people considered climate change `` skeptics '' argued that the emails showed global warming was a scientific conspiracy , that scientists manipulated climate data and attempted to suppress critics . The CRU rejected this , saying the emails had been taken out of context and merely reflected an honest exchange of ideas . The mainstream media picked up the story as negotiations over climate change mitigation began in Copenhagen on 7 December 2009 . Because of the timing , scientists , policy makers and public relations experts said that the release of emails was a smear campaign intended to undermine the climate conference . In response to the controversy , the American Association for the Advancement of Science ( AAAS ) , the American Meteorological Society ( AMS ) and the Union of Concerned Scientists ( UCS ) released statements supporting the scientific consensus that the Earth 's mean surface temperature had been rising for decades , with the AAAS concluding , `` based on multiple lines of scientific evidence that global climate change caused by human activities is now underway ... it is a growing threat to society . '' Eight committees investigated the allegations and published reports , finding no evidence of fraud or scientific misconduct . However , the reports called on the scientists to avoid any such allegations in the future by taking steps to regain public confidence in their work , for example by opening up access to their supporting data , processing methods and software , and by promptly honouring freedom of information requests . The scientific consensus that global warming is occurring as a result of human activity remained unchanged throughout the investigations . |

1510 | Climate_change_feedback | Doubling the concentration of atmospheric CO2 from its pre-industrial level, in the absence of other forcings and feedbacks, would likely cause a warming of ~0.3°C to 1.1°C. | Climate change feedback Climate change feedback is important in the understanding of global warming because feedback processes may amplify or diminish the effect of each climate forcing , and so play an important part in determining the climate sensitivity and future climate state . Feedback in general is the process in which changing one quantity changes a second quantity , and the change in the second quantity in turn changes the first . Positive feedback amplifies the change in the first quantity while negative feedback reduces it . The term `` forcing '' means a change which may `` push '' the climate system in the direction of warming or cooling . An example of a climate forcing is increased atmospheric concentrations of greenhouse gases . By definition , forcings are external to the climate system while feedbacks are internal ; in essence , feedbacks represent the internal processes of the system . Some feedbacks may act in relative isolation to the rest of the climate system ; others may be tightly coupled ; hence it may be difficult to tell just how much a particular process contributes . Forcings , feedbacks and the dynamics of the climate system determine how much and how fast the climate changes . The main positive feedback in global warming is the tendency of warming to increase the amount of water vapor in the atmosphere , which in turn leads to further warming . The main negative feedback comes from the Stefan -- Boltzmann law , the amount of heat radiated from the Earth into space changes with the fourth power of the temperature of Earth 's surface and atmosphere . Some observed and potential effects of global warming are positive feedbacks , which contribute directly to further global warming . The Intergovernmental Panel on Climate Change 's ( IPCC ) Fourth Assessment Report states that `` Anthropogenic warming could lead to some effects that are abrupt or irreversible , depending upon the rate and magnitude of the climate change . 261 | Temperature_record_of_the_past_1000_years | in 1995 one scientist at the IPCC – Jonathan Overpeck – wrote an email to a colleague claiming 'we have to get rid of the Medieval Warm Period.' | Temperature record of the past 1000 years For information on the description of the Medieval Warm Period and Little Ice Age in various IPCC reports see MWP and LIA in IPCC reportsThe temperature record of the past 1,000 years is reconstructed using data from climate proxy records in conjunction with the modern instrumental temperature record which only covers the last 150 years at a global scale . Large-scale reconstructions covering part or all of the 1st millennium and 2nd millennium have shown that recent temperatures are exceptional : the Intergovernmental Panel on Climate Change Fourth Assessment Report of 2007 concluded that `` Average Northern Hemisphere temperatures during the second half of the 20th century were very likely higher than during any other 50-year period in the last 500 years and likely '' the highest in at least the past 1,300 years . '' The curve shown in graphs of these reconstructions is widely known as the hockey stick graph because of the sharp increase in temperatures during the last century . As of 2010 this broad pattern was supported by more than two dozen reconstructions , using various statistical methods and combinations of proxy records , with variations in how flat the pre-20th-century `` shaft '' appears . Sparseness of proxy records results in considerable uncertainty for earlier periods . Individual proxy records , such as tree ring widths and densities used in dendroclimatology , are calibrated against the instrumental record for the period of overlap . Networks of such records are used to reconstruct past temperatures for regions : tree ring proxies have been used to reconstruct Northern Hemisphere extratropical temperatures ( within the tropics trees do not form rings ) but are confined to land areas and are scarce in the Southern Hemisphere which is largely ocean . Wider coverage is provided by multiproxy reconstructions , incorporating proxies such as lake sediments , ice cores and corals which are found in different regions , and using statistical methods to relate these sparser proxies to the greater numbers of tree ring records . The `` Composite Plus Scaling '' ( CPS ) method is widely used for large-scale multiproxy reconstructions of hemispheric or global average temperatures ; this is complemented by Climate Field Reconstruction ( CFR ) methods which show how climate patterns have developed over large spatial areas , making the reconstruction useful for investigating natural variability and long-term oscillations as well as for comparisons with patterns produced by climate models . During the 1,900 years before the 20th century , it is likely that the next warmest period was from 950 to 1100 , with peaks at different times in different regions . This has been called the Medieval Warm Period , and some evidence suggests widespread cooler conditions during a period around the 17th century known as the Little Ice Age . In the hockey stick controversy , contrarians have asserted that the Medieval Warm Period was warmer than at present , and have disputed the data and methods of climate reconstructions . |

2119 | Iris_hypothesis | Lindzen and Choi find low climate sensitivity | Iris hypothesis The iris hypothesis is a hypothesis proposed by Richard Lindzen et al. in 2001 that suggested increased sea surface temperature in the tropics would result in reduced cirrus clouds and thus more infrared radiation leakage from Earth 's atmosphere . His study of observed changes in cloud coverage and modeled effects on infrared radiation released to space as a result supported the hypothesis . This suggested infrared radiation leakage was hypothesized to be a negative feedback in which an initial warming would result in an overall cooling of the surface . The consensus view is that increased sea surface temperature would result in increased cirrus clouds and reduced infrared radiation leakage and therefore a positive feedback . Other scientists subsequently tested the hypothesis . Some concluded that there was no evidence supporting the hypothesis . Others found evidence suggesting that increased sea surface temperature in the tropics did indeed reduce cirrus clouds but found that the effect was nonetheless a positive feedback rather than the negative feedback that Lindzen had hypothesized . A later 2007 study conducted by Roy Spencer et al. using updated satellite data potentially supported the iris hypothesis . In 2011 , Lindzen published a rebuttal to the main criticisms . In 2015 a paper was published which again suggested the possibility of an `` Iris Effect '' . It also proposed what it called a `` plausible physical mechanism for an iris effect . '' |

1544 | Arctic_oscillation | Arctic icemelt is a natural cycle. | Arctic oscillation The Arctic oscillation ( AO ) or Northern Annular Mode/Northern Hemisphere Annular Mode ( NAM ) is an index ( which varies over time with no particular periodicity ) of the dominant pattern of non-seasonal sea-level pressure variations north of 20N latitude , and it is characterized by pressure anomalies of one sign in the Arctic with the opposite anomalies centered about 37 -- 45N . The AO is believed by climatologists to be causally related to , and thus partially predictive of , weather patterns in locations many thousands of miles away , including many of the major population centers of Europe and North America . NASA climatologist Dr. James E. Hansen explained the mechanism by which the AO affects weather at points so distant from the Arctic , as follows : `` The degree to which Arctic air penetrates into middle latitudes is related to the AO index , which is defined by surface atmospheric pressure patterns . When the AO index is positive , surface pressure is low in the polar region . This helps the middle latitude jet stream to blow strongly and consistently from west to east , thus keeping cold Arctic air locked in the polar region . When the AO index is negative , there tends to be high pressure in the polar region , weaker zonal winds , and greater movement of frigid polar air into middle latitudes . '' This zonally symmetric seesaw between sea level pressures in polar and temperate latitudes was first identified by Edward Lorenz and named in 1998 by David W.J. Thompson and John Michael Wallace . The North Atlantic oscillation ( NAO ) is a close relative of the AO and there exist arguments about whether one or the other is more fundamentally representative of the atmosphere 's dynamics ; Ambaum et al. argue that the NAO can be identified in a more physically meaningful way . Over most of the past century , the Arctic Oscillation alternated between its positive and negative phases . Starting in the 1970s the oscillation has trended to more of a positive phase when averaged using a 60-day running mean , though it has trended to a more neutral state in the last decade . The oscillation still fluctuates stochastically between negative and positive values on daily , monthly , seasonal and annual time scales , although , despite its stochastic nature , meteorologists have attained high levels of predictive accuracy in recent times , at least for the shorter term forecasts . ( The correlation between actual observations and the 7-day mean GFS ensemble AO forecasts is approximately 0.9 , a figure at the high end for that statistic . ) The National Snow and Ice Data Center describes the effects of the AO in some detail : `` In the positive phase , higher pressure at midlatitudes drives ocean storms farther north , and changes in the circulation pattern bring wetter weather to Alaska , Scotland and Scandinavia , as well as drier conditions to the western United States and the Mediterranean . In the positive phase , frigid winter air does not extend as far into the middle of North America as it would during the negative phase of the oscillation . This keeps much of the United States east of the Rocky Mountains warmer than normal , but leaves Greenland and Newfoundland colder than usual . Weather patterns in the negative phase are in general `` opposite '' to those of the positive phase . '' Climatologists are now routinely invoking the Arctic Oscillation in their official public explanations for extremes of weather . The following statement from the National Oceanic and Atmospheric Administration 's National Climatic Data Center : State of the Climate December 2010 which uses the phrase `` negative Arctic Oscillation '' four times , is very representative of this increasing tendency : `` Cold arctic air gripped western Europe in the first three weeks of December . Two major snowstorms , icy conditions , and frigid temperatures wreaked havoc across much of the region ... The harsh winter weather was attributed to a negative Arctic Oscillation , which is a climate pattern that influences weather in the Northern Hemisphere . A very persistent , strong ridge of high pressure , or ` blocking system ' , near Greenland allowed cold Arctic air to slide south into Europe . Europe was not the only region in the Northern Hemisphere affected by the Arctic Oscillation . A large snow storm and frigid temperatures affected much of the Midwest United States on December 10 -- 13 ... '' A further , quite graphic illustration of the effects of the negative phase of the oscillation occurred in February 2010 . In that month , the Arctic Oscillation reached its most negative monthly mean value , − 4.266 , in the entire post-1950 era ( the period of accurate record-keeping ) . That month was characterized by three separate historic snowstorms that occurred in the mid-Atlantic region of the United States . The first storm dumped 25 in on Baltimore , Maryland , on February 5 -- 6 , and then a second storm dumped 19.5 in on February 9 -- 10 . In New York City , a separate storm deposited 20.9 in on February 25 -- 26 . This kind of snowstorm activity is as anomalous and extreme as the negative AO value itself . Similarly , the greatest negative value for the AO since 1950 in January was − 3.767 in 1977 , which coincided with the coldest mean January temperature in New York City , Washington , D.C. , Baltimore , and many other mid-Atlantic locations in that span of time . And though the January AO has been negative only 60.6 % of the time between 1950 and 2010 , 9 of the 10 coldest Januarys in New York City since 1950 have coincided with negative AOs . However , the correlation between sharply negative Arctic Oscillations and excessive winter cold and snow in regions vulnerable in that way to these negative AOs should not be overstated . It is by no means a simple , one-to-one equivalence . An extreme Arctic Oscillation does not necessarily mean extreme weather will occur . For example , since 1950 , eight out of the 10 coldest Januarys in New York did not coincide with the 10 lowest January AO values . And the fourth warmest January there since 1950 coincided with one of those 10 most negative AOs . So , although many climatologists believe that the Arctic Oscillation affects the probability of certain weather events occurring in certain places , the heightened chance of a phenomenon by no means assures it , nor does the lessened likelihood exclude it . Further , the precise value of the AO index only imperfectly reflects the severity of the weather associated with it . |

1020 | Cretaceous–Paleogene_extinction_event | "The global reef crisis does not necessarily mean extinction for coral species. | Cretaceous–Paleogene extinction event The Cretaceous -- Paleogene ( K -- Pg ) extinction event , also known as the Cretaceous -- Tertiary ( K -- T ) extinction , was a mass extinction of some three-quarters of the plant and animal species on Earth that occurred over a geologically short period of time approximately 65 million years ago . With the exception of some ectothermic species like the leatherback sea turtle and crocodiles , no tetrapods weighing more than 25 kg survived . It marked the end of the Cretaceous period and with it , the entire Mesozoic Era , opening the Cenozoic Era that continues today . In the geologic record , the K -- Pg event is marked by a thin layer of sediment called the K -- Pg boundary , which can be found throughout the world in marine and terrestrial rocks . The boundary clay shows high levels of the metal iridium , which is rare in the Earth 's crust but abundant in asteroids . As originally proposed in 1980 by a team of scientists led by Luis Alvarez , it is now generally thought that the K -- Pg extinction was caused by a massive comet or asteroid impact , estimated to be 10 km wide , 66 million years ago and its catastrophic effects on the global environment , including a lingering impact winter that made it impossible for plants and plankton to carry out photosynthesis . The impact hypothesis , also known as the Alvarez hypothesis , was bolstered by the discovery of the 180 km Chicxulub crater in the Gulf of Mexico in the early 1990s , which provided conclusive evidence that the K -- Pg boundary clay represented debris from an asteroid impact . The fact that the extinctions occurred at the same time as the impact provides strong situational evidence that the K -- Pg extinction was caused by the asteroid . It was possibly accelerated by the creation of the Deccan Traps . However , some scientists maintain the extinction was caused or exacerbated by other factors , such as volcanic eruptions , climate change , or sea level change , separately or together . A wide range of species perished in the K -- Pg extinction . The best-known victims are the non-avian dinosaurs . However , the extinction also destroyed a plethora of other terrestrial organisms , including certain mammals , pterosaurs , birds , lizards , insects , and plants . In the oceans , the K -- Pg extinction killed off plesiosaurs and the giant marine lizards ( Mosasauridae ) and devastated fish , sharks , mollusks ( especially ammonites , which became extinct ) and many species of plankton . It is estimated that 75 % or more of all species on Earth vanished . Yet the devastation caused by the extinction also provided evolutionary opportunities . In the wake of the extinction , many groups underwent remarkable adaptive radiations -- a sudden and prolific divergence into new forms and species within the disrupted and emptied ecological niches resulting from the event . Mammals in particular diversified in the Paleogene , producing new forms such as horses , whales , bats , and primates . Birds , fish and perhaps lizards also radiated . |

1135 | Coral_bleaching | Scientists confirm a mass bleaching event on the Great Barrier Reef this year has killed more corals than ever before, with more than two thirds destroyed across large swathes of the biodiverse site. | Coral bleaching Coral bleaching occurs when coral polyps expel algae that lives inside their tissues . Normally , coral polyps live in an endosymbiotic relationship with the algae and that relationship is crucial for the coral and hence for the health of the whole reef . Bleached corals continue to live . But as the algae provide the coral with 90 % of its energy , after expelling the algae the coral begins to starve . Above-average sea water temperatures caused by global warming have been identified as a leading cause for coral bleaching worldwide . Between 2014 and 2016 , the longest global bleaching events ever were recorded . According to the United Nations Environment Programme , these bleaching events killed coral on an unprecedented scale . In 2016 , bleaching hit 90 percent of coral on the Great Barrier Reef and killed 29 percent of the reef 's coral .
